💰 $200 - $70,000 📅 08/07/2024
ApplyAbout Us:
We leverage cutting-edge technology to drive innovation within data and AI.
Our solutions are designed to be intuitive and scalable, optimizing
performance and enhancing business outcomes through data-driven insights. Join
us to impact data solutions in new ways with your expertise.
Role Overview:
We are looking for a Technical Project Lead to oversee the architecture and
development of our user-facing applications. This role is pivotal in designing
robust APIs, managing system integrations, and ensuring the software lifecycle
is managed efficiently from concept to deployment.
Key Responsibilities:
System Architecture & Development: Design and develop scalable backend systems
and APIs that ensure seamless data flow across various application components.
Security Implementation: Implement robust security frameworks using
technologies like OAuth, SAML, and JWT to safeguard data and privacy.
Project Leadership: Lead the execution and delivery of complex software
projects, ensuring technical specifications and deadlines are met.
Lifecycle Management: Oversee all phases of the software development
lifecycle, ensuring high standards of quality from design to deployment.
Collaboration: Collaborate with product managers, data scientists, and UI/UX
designers to ensure a unified and effective user experience.
Innovation and Improvement: Evaluate and integrate new technologies and
frameworks to improve functionality and system performance.
Required Skills and Experience:
Demonstrated experience in backend or full-stack development, particularly
using Node.js, Python, and Java.
Proficiency in designing and developing APIs and backend systems.
Strong knowledge of event-driven architecture and experience with message
brokers like Apache Pulsar or Kafka.
Expertise in microservices architecture and distributed systems.
Experience with containerization and orchestration technologies such as Docker
and Kubernetes.
Skilled in modern CI/CD methodologies.
Excellent problem-solving capabilities and project management skills.
Strong communication and team collaboration abilities.
Desirable Qualifications:
Bachelor’s or Master’s degree in Computer Science, Engineering, or related
field.
Experience with cloud platforms and services, such as AWS, GCP and Azure.
Background in developing scalable solutions from the ground up in a startup
environment.
Familiarity with front-end development frameworks relevant to our technology
stack.
What We Offer:
A pivotal role in shaping the Data and AI space through technology at a
pioneering company.
Competitive remuneration and benefits.
Remote work flexibility.
A dynamic, innovative, and inclusive workplace.
Extensive opportunities for professional growth in a rapidly expanding firm.